Fuelled by farts, this is fast-paced and a delightfully ridiculous adventure from a debut children's writer but a well established and bestselling adult author Jo Nesbø who has been fairly compared to Stieg Larsson, the creator of The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o. Newly moved into the neighbourhood, Nilly meets a strange old man who turns out to be Doctor Proctor, an almost famous inventor who is about to come up with a super-strength fart powder which can propel people into outer space. Can Nilly and his new friend Lisa help the mad professor and can they keep the fart powder safe from those who want to steal it?

Doctor Proctor's Fart Powder Synopsis
Doctor Proctor has finally created something to help him fulfil his dream of becoming a famous inventor - a super-strength fart powder that can propel people into outer space! And with the help of his new neighbour Nilly, and Nilly's friend Lisa, Doctor Proctor's Fart Powder is ready to go worldwide! But ruthless twins Truls and Trym are determined to get hold of the powder for themselves. Their plot to spoil the Doctor's plans sparks a fart-filled adventure involving a firework extravaganza, a trip to prison and an escaped anaconda.
Jo Nesbo creates wonderfully weird characters and lets his imagination run wild in this first book of the Doctor Proctor series.
A must read for fans of David Walliams and Roald Dahl.

About Jo Nesbo
Jo Nesbø is the most successful Norwegian author of all time, selling millions of his adult novels worldwide and becoming widely recognised as one of Europe's foremost crime writers. His debut children's book, Doctor Proctor's Fart Powder, sold more copies in his native Norway than any other children's debut, and rights have been sold in more than 25 countries, including the US.
Revealing Questions for Jo Nesbø:
Q. If you could be anywhere in the world right now, where would you choose to be?
A. In a climbing wall at Ton Sai, Thailand
Q. What’s your greatest flaw?
A. Laziness
Q. What’s your best quality?
A. Imagination
Q. Who is your favourite fictional hero?
A. Batman
Q. Who is your favourite fictional villain?
A. Joker
Q. What is your favourite occupation, when you’re not writing?
A. Rock climbing and guitar playing.
Q. If you could eat only one thing for the rest of your days, what would it be?
A. Bananas.
Q. What are your 5 favourite songs?
A. One. Perfect Skin, Lloyd Cole and the Commotions, Strawberry Fields by the Beatles, Independence Day by Bruce Springsteen, Shipbuilding by Elvis Costello, There She Goes by the Las.
On Books and Writing:
Q. Who are your favourite authors?
A. Knut Hamsun, Vladimir Nabokov, Jim Thompson, Ernest Hemingway, Henrik Ibsen, Charles Bukowski, Charles Dickens, Mark Twain.
Q. Is there a book you love to reread?
A. No. I never do. I probably should, but there are too many books, and I´m such a slow reader and with a limited life span.
Q. Do you have one sentence of advice for new writers?
A. Know your story and then tell it, not the other way around.
Q. What comment do you hear most often from your readers?
A. Are you insane?
